The Greenstone House in Vermont’s Northeast Kingdom!
This home is a charming, minimalist style colonial that has been completely renovated from top-to-bottom. You’ll be in an ideal location; just 2/10 mile to the Vermont Association of Snow Travelers trail system (VAST); 1.2 miles to the well-known Kingdom Trails providing a mountain biking network of over 85 miles of single and doubletrack; 10 minutes to Burke Mountain Ski & Bike Park; 10 minutes Dashney Nordic Center; 15 minutes to Mount Pisgah; and beautiful 1,653 acre Lake Willoughby. You will be welcomed by a large, wrap-around porch, including outdoor seating; a propane gas grill; and a deck-mounted bike stand for tinkering and adjustments. The main floor has an open-floor plan; purposefully designed to include an entertaining space with a propane fireplace and Smart TV, adjoining a fully equipped kitchen with all new appliances. Every detail has been considered to make the cooking and gathering experience enjoyable. In addition, the first level contains a dining room area with seating for 6; as well as a bathroom with walk-in shower. There are 3 bedrooms; an additional full bath with clawfoot tub; and washer/dryer located upstairs. The master bedroom contains a California king-size bed. Bedroom 2 includes a queen-size bed. In Bedroom 3, you will find a twin trundle for sleeping flexibility (totaling sleeping spaces for 6 people in all). All mattresses and bedding are new. Radiant Heating throughout the top and bottom floors of house. Towels, a hair dryer, and basic toiletries are provided. Our property is located on 11 acres which you are welcome to explore, although the forest can be dense at certain times of the year. My favorite part of the outdoor landscape is our 4-person, adult seesaw. This can truly be quite hysterical while in the company of friends. The wood burning firepit is large; and seems to complement the Vermont star-gazing experience. There is room to park up to 3 cars: with reliable plowing and automatic lights for security and comfort.
